Poem/story/mnemonic about the countries in WWII and their involvement for little kids...Something about Turkey and Greece...
There was a poem or mnemonic about WWII I heard when I was little that explained how countries were involved and all I can remember is something about Turkey (made to sound like the food) and Greece (made to sound like the stuff you fry things with). Does anyone know this, or where I can get it?

The one that my mum used to say was:
Germany was Hungary,
Ate a bit of Turkey
On a bit of China,
Dipped in Greece.
I didn't ever know about it being a mnemonic though.
